Biography of Dee Dee Blanchard

Dee Dee Blanchard was born on September 4, 1967, in Chackbay, Louisiana. She was a single mother to her daughter Gypsy Rose Blanchard, whom she raised under unusual and often harmful circumstances. Dee Dee claimed that Gypsy suffered from a variety of health issues, including leukemia, muscular dystrophy, and severe allergies, among others. Many of these claims were later revealed to be fabrications, leading to a complex and tragic relationship between mother and daughter.

Early Life and Relationships

Dee Dee had a troubled childhood, marked by her parents' tumultuous relationship and her mother's alleged mental health issues. This background likely influenced her later behavior and the dynamics within her own family. She married Rod Blanchard, Gypsy's father, but their marriage was short-lived. Rod stated that Dee Dee exhibited controlling behavior even during their brief relationship.

The Crime: An Overview

On June 14, 2015, Dee Dee Blanchard was found murdered in her home in Springfield, Missouri. Her death was the culmination of years of psychological abuse and manipulation. Gypsy Rose Blanchard, who had been subjected to her mother's controlling behavior and fabricated illnesses, was arrested for her mother's murder along with her boyfriend, Nicholas Godejohn.

Details of the Murder

The murder itself was premeditated, as Gypsy and Nicholas had plotted to kill Dee Dee to escape the abusive situation. Gypsy had grown increasingly aware of the truth about her mother's lies and wished to break free from the confines of her fabricated illnesses. The crime shocked the nation and sparked discussions about mental illness, abuse, and the extent of parental control.

Understanding Munchausen Syndrome by Proxy

Munchausen syndrome by proxy is a psychological disorder in which a caregiver, typically a parent, exaggerates or induces illness in a person under their care. In Dee Dee Blanchard's case, she had been accused of fabricating her daughter's illnesses for years, leading to Gypsy's severe psychological and emotional distress.

Impact on Gypsy Rose Blanchard

Gypsy's experience under her mother's care left deep psychological scars. The manipulation and control she faced played a significant role in her actions leading to the tragic outcome. Understanding this psychological aspect is crucial for recognizing the complexities of their relationship.

Impact of the Case on Society

The murder of Dee Dee Blanchard and the subsequent trial of Gypsy Rose Blanchard highlighted several critical societal issues, including the need for better awareness of Munchausen syndrome by proxy and the complexities of mental health in familial relationships. The case prompted discussions about the responsibilities of healthcare providers in recognizing signs of abuse and the importance of protecting vulnerable individuals.

Gypsy Rose Blanchard was charged with second-degree murder and was sentenced to 10 years in prison. Her case raised questions about the legal system's treatment of victims of abuse, particularly those who become perpetrators in response to their trauma. The public has largely sympathized with Gypsy, recognizing her as a victim of her mother's manipulative behavior.
